Carlyle Credit Income Fund's 7.375% Series D Term Preferred Shares (CCID) reported Q1 2026 earnings per share of $0.09, missing the consensus estimate of $0.1318 by a significant 31.71%. Revenue was not applicable due to the fund's closed-end structure. Despite the earnings miss, the preferred shares rose by $0.55 in the trading session, reflecting investor focus on dividend stability rather than near-term EPS volatility.

As a closed-end fund, CCID's earnings are primarily driven by net investment income from its portfolio of floating-rate credit investments, including senior secured loans and structured credit. The reported EPS of $0.09 suggests that net investment income for the quarter was weaker than anticipated, potentially due to tighter credit spreads, lower prepayment fees, or a slight decrease in portfolio yield. The fund's management had previously highlighted a diversified portfolio with a focus on preserving capital while generating current income, but the Q1 results indicate a compression in earnings relative to analyst expectations. Operational highlights may include continued distribution of monthly dividends, which are a key attraction for preferred shareholders. However, the EPS miss raises questions about the sustainability of the current dividend payout level relative to reported earnings. The fund’s net asset value (NAV) per share and leverage ratios are important context—though not explicitly provided in the report, the earnings shortfall could mean that NAV coverage of the preferred dividend remains intact but with a narrower margin. Guidance from the fund’s manager, Carlyle, was not provided for Q1, but the earnings miss may prompt a more cautious tone regarding future net investment income. Management expects that the portfolio’s floating-rate nature offers some protection against interest rate changes, yet the current rate environment shows signs of plateauing, which could limit further income growth. Strategically, the fund may continue to emphasize credit selection and risk management, especially given potential economic headwinds such as slower corporate earnings growth and elevated default risk in certain sectors. The reported EPS of just $0.09 per share—below the typical quarterly dividend on the preferred shares—suggests that the fund might need to rely on capital gains or distributable cash reserves to maintain the stated dividend. Risk factors include a potential widening of credit spreads, lower loan syndication volumes, and any increase in non-accrual assets. Investors should monitor the fund's next net asset value report and distribution announcement for signs of adjustment. The stock’s positive price reaction of $0.55 despite the large earnings miss may seem counterintuitive, but preferred shares often trade on yield and dividend coverage rather than quarterly EPS alone. Analysts likely note that the fund's underlying credit portfolio remains high-quality and that the miss was primarily due to timing of income recognition or one-off items. The stock’s rise could also reflect a broader market rally in preferred securities or a belief that the fund will maintain its 7.375% coupon. Looking ahead, key items to watch include the monthly dividend declaration, any changes to the distribution policy, and the fund’s quarterly portfolio composition report. If net investment income fails to recover, the preferred dividend may come under pressure. Conversely, if credit markets improve, the fund could see a rebound in earnings. The cautious language used by management in upcoming communications will be critical in shaping investor sentiment.
